Place beets in a pot and cover with water.
Bring to a boil, then simmer for 30–40 minutes until tender.
Drain, let cool slightly, then peel and slice into rounds or wedges.
Prepare the Pickling Liquid
In a saucepan, combine vinegar, water, sugar, salt, and optional spices.
Bring to a simmer and stir until sugar dissolves.
Pickle the Beets
Place sliced beets into a clean jar or container.
Pour hot pickling liquid over the beets, making sure they are fully submerged.
Let cool to room temperature, then cover and refrigerate.
Marinate
For best flavor, allow the beets to marinate at least 24 hours before serving.
